Chad Henne and Laurent Robinson head to Jacksonville.
Peyton Hillis goes to Kansas City. Soliai is signed by Miami. Mario Williams is still in Buffalo, possible signing tomorrow. Manning has met with Tennessee, supposedly ending his lookover trip. Flynn meets with Seattle tomorrow. DJax re-signs with Philadelphia, 5 years for $48.5M. Megatron re-signs with Detroit, 8 year for $130M.
